What is a clothing factory?

A clothing factory encompasses the entire scope of clothing production, meaning it is a business, company, or service that focuses on designing and producing garments.

However, not all clothing factories offer the services that brands or companies are looking for. It depends on the type of brand, the area the brand focuses on, and its type of product or business model.

Types of clothing factories

Maquila

A maquila or dressmaking workshop are smaller businesses dedicated solely to garment assembly/sewing.

This business does not engage in design or pattern making and may not offer cutting services in some cases.

Full package

The full package actually takes care of everything for the client, freeing them from production worries so they can focus solely on sales. Because it's such a comprehensive service, its cost is slightly higher compared to traditional maquila services.

Private label

Private Label, or in Spanish, marca privada, is a service where the brand or company can purchase prefabricated designs/ready-made items without any labels or logos from the manufacturing company.

Dressmakers, tailors, and seamstresses

These are services offered by individuals who are generally a smaller, scaled-down version of a dressmaking workshop or maquila.

These are usually businesses where 3-5 people work on sewing, altering clothes, or making custom garments.

In Colombia, we have institutions like Procolombia that seek to connect international clients with local companies, manufacturers, and distributors.

Directories:

Procolombia, like other institutions, has digital directories with a compact database of allied manufacturers in Colombia.

Recommendations:

This method is traditional but efficient for finding clothing factories in Colombia. For this, you need to have contacts in the industry to ask them about their manufacturers and their experience with them.

However, you can also go to the profiles of these companies and contact them via email to request the same information if you don't have this contact base.
